The Department of Justice has filed a motion to join a class-action lawsuit against the City of Evanston's reparations program, claiming it unlawfully distributes benefits based on race. The program, which provides $25,000 grants to eligible Black residents, is being challenged for potentially violating the Equal Protection Clause and the Fair Housing Act. The litigation began in May 2024, and the DOJ's intervention is currently pending in court.

Donald Trump has settled a $100 million lawsuit against his niece, Mary Trump, over allegations that she leaked his tax records to the media. The lawsuit, filed in 2021, claimed that she violated confidentiality agreements related to the Trump family estate. The settlement was confirmed in a letter filed with a New York state court.
